Experience the thrill of a floatplane take off before climbing above Mokoia Island on track to our hidden lakes district. Climbing over our eastern ridgeline our terrain reveals the lakes of Okataina, Tarawera, Okareka, Rotokakahi (Green Lake) and Tikitapu (Blue Lake). These stunning crater lakes are surrounded by native forests and pastoral lands, hidden from the city by volcanic terrain. Only an aerial perspective reveals the true beauty of this region. Returning to the Lakefront the descent takes you across the Rotorua city before landing back at Lake Rotorua.

At Te Puia, experience the raw power of Te Whakarewarewa geothermal valley with bubbling mud pools, steaming vents and the world famous Pohutu Geyser. Take a journey into the heart of Maori culture, arts and crafts. Learning the stories and traditions of this valley from its people. Find out why the Tongariro Crossing is often referred to as the best one day walk in New Zealand, (if not the world), with a guide who will reveal some of the secrets of this stunning area. Enjoy an unhurried experience over Tongariro, avoiding the crowds, walking at your pace and not to a timetable. Take in the varied colours and textures as the landscape changes dramatically throughout the day.
This challenging one day alpine trek covers a little over 19km (12 miles) and encounters a varied range of landforms and views, with areas of geological importance and great cultural significance, as it heads up and over Mt Tongariro. The direction that you will walk this track makes good sense, climbing some 776m (or 2528ft), but descending a total of 1126m (or 3716ft)! Your guide will help interpret the volcanic, flora and Lord of the Rings stories during this exhilarating day trip.
Once you are back in Turangi, why not test out your fishing skills. As the unofficial trout fishing headquarters of New Zealand, the town is on the banks of the Tongariro River, Lake Taupo is only four kilometres away and the Tauranga-Taupo River (another trout haven) is just to the east.
